Potential Side Effects
As with any anabolic steroid, Test C 250 can cause side effects, especially if used at high doses or for extended periods. Common side effects include:
- Acne
- Increased aggression
- Hair loss
- Changes in libido
- Gynecomastia (breast tissue development in men)
